Man Utd defender Jones: Chicharito will get great reception. We must watch him!

Manchester United defender Phil Jones says they must be wary facing West Ham striker Javier Hernandez today.

The striker known as Chicharito served the Reds between 2010 and 2015, and Jones believes the United faithful will give the Mexican a warm welcome should he feature on Sunday.

“I think he'll get a great reception, he was very well liked here, not just as a player but as a professional off the pitch," the Reds defender continued. “He was a good player and he'll be a tough opponent, but we've got to make sure we do our things right and perform as well as we can do."

Jones was also keen to pay homage to the United fans all over the world who support the club, as well as those who will be attending the match on Sunday.

“The support around the world is massively appreciated – we feel it every game," he added. “Whether you're there or you're not there and cheering us on through the TV – we feel that.

“When the results don't go so well, we feel the pain as much as they do, but that's what we're about and we stick together through the tough times and the good times. Hopefully we'll have more good times than bad times this season."
